You don`t need to associate PDFs with any reader,just install all of them(FoxitReader,ClearVue PDF and Acrobat Reader).
Open your PDFs from the program,but not from File Explorer.

Now you need File Dialog Changer - v1.65,the program replaces the "Save As..." & "Open..." dialog box in applications and provides a decidely more complete interface with more ergonomic navigation.It`s free.
http://www.pocketpcfreewares.com/en/index.php?soft=752
http://www.geocities.co.jp/SiliconVa...upertino/2039/
1. Copy filedlgchg.cpl & GsGetFile.dll into windows folder
2. Goto Settings, click icon "File Dialog Changer"
3. **CHECK checkbox "Exchange Standard File Dialog"**

Now with your program you can open your PDFs wherever they are.So you can choose which program to open them.
